Nairaland General › How To Reverse Nairaland’s Colour Change On Your Phone. by Immanuel3(op): 12:24pm On Apr 01, 2023 |
Hello Nairalanders, if you're a Nairaland user who misses the old color view of the site, you can bring it back by changing the contrast on your phone to classic invert. This setting, which can be found in your phone's accessibility options, will flip the colors on your screen to create a high-contrast display that makes it easier to read and navigate the site.
To change the contrast on your phone to classic invert, follow these steps:
Step 1: Open your phone's settings menu Depending on your phone's make and model, you can find this by tapping on the gear icon in your app drawer or by swiping down from the top of your screen and tapping on the settings icon.
Step 2: Navigate to the Accessibility menu This is where you can find the settings for changing your phone's contrast. Depending on your phone, you may need to scroll down to find this menu.
Step 3: Select Display options Look for the option labeled "Display" or "Display options".
Step 4: Enable Classic Invert Tap on "Color Inversion" or "Invert Colors" and look for the option labeled "Classic Invert". Enable it.
Step 5: Adjust other settings You may also have additional options for adjusting the contrast of your screen. Play around with these settings to find the best combination for your needs.
Once you have enabled classic invert on your phone, you can enjoy Nairaland.com in the old color look. Simply open your web browser and navigate to Nairaland.com. The classic invert setting will be applied to the entire display of your phone, making it easier to read and navigate the site.
Keep in mind that while classic invert can be a helpful accessibility feature for some users, it may not be ideal for everyone. Some colors and images may appear distorted or difficult to recognize with this setting enabled. If you find that classic invert is not working for you, simply go back into your phone's settings and turn it off.
Overall, changing the contrast on your phone to classic invert can be a helpful way to bring back the old color view of Nairaland.com. Give it a try and see if it works for you!
